EPSS (Exploit Prediction Scoring System) is a daily probability model maintained by FIRST.org. It estimates the likelihood a CVE will be exploited in production environments within the next 30 days, derived from real-world threat intelligence signals.

Description

Parse Server is an open source backend that can be deployed to any infrastructure that can run Node.js. Prior to versions 8.6.2 and 9.1.1-alpha.1, the Instagram authentication adapter allows clients to specify a custom API URL via the apiURL parameter in authData. This enables SSRF attacks and possibly authentication bypass if malicious endpoints return fake responses to validate unauthorized users. This is fixed in versions 8.6.2 and 9.1.1-alpha.1 by hardcoding the Instagram Graph API URL https://graph.instagram.com and ignoring client-provided apiURL values. No known workarounds are available.
